<p> <h2>High-end Paint Protection Film Market Size and Forecast</h2><p>The global High-end Paint Protection Film market size was valued at USD 420.5 Million in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 1,032.5 Million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 11.6% from 2024 to 2030. This growth is driven by increasing demand for automotive protection products and rising awareness regarding vehicle aesthetics and preservation. High-end Paint Protection Films are used extensively in the automotive sector to protect vehicles from scratches, chips, and other forms of damage. The increasing adoption of high-end vehicles and the growing trend of vehicle customization are further fueling the demand for premium-quality paint protection solutions. Moreover, advancements in film technology, including self-healing and UV-resistant features, are expected to further expand the market during the forecast period.</p><p>In 2022, North America dominated the High-end Paint Protection Film market, accounting for over 35% of the global market share, owing to the high disposable income and demand for luxury vehicles in the region. The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ness the highest growth rate during the forecast period, driven by the rising demand for premium cars and a growing automotive aftermarket industry. What is high-end paint protection film?</strong><br>High-end paint protection film is a transparent, durable layer applied to a vehicle's paint to protect it from scratches, chips, and other types of damage. It is typically made of polyurethane or a similar material that offers self-healing properties.</p><p><strong>2. How long does paint protection film last?</strong><br>With proper care, high-end paint protection film can last anywhere from 5 to 10 years, depending on factors such as the type of film, vehicle usage, and environmental conditions.</p><p><strong>3. Can paint protection film be removed?</strong><br>Yes, paint protection film can be safely removed without damaging the underlying paint. However, it is recommended to have the film removed by a professional to avoid any risk of surface damage.</p><p><strong>4. Is paint protection film visible on the car?</strong><br>High-quality paint protection film is almost invisible once applied, ensuring that it does not alter the vehicle’s appearance while still providing effective protection.</p><p><strong>5. What is the difference between whole vehicle and part of vehicle paint protection film?</strong><br>Whole vehicle protection covers the entire exterior of the vehicle, while part of vehicle protection targets specific areas that are more prone to damage, such as the front bumper or side mirrors.</p><p><strong>6. Can I apply paint protection film myself?</strong><br>While it is possible to apply paint protection film yourself, professional installation is recommended to ensure a flawless finish and optimal protection.</p><p><strong>7. How does paint protection film protect my vehicle?</strong><br>Paint protection film acts as a shield against physical damage like scratches, chips, and stains, as well as environmental elements like UV rays, bird droppings, and road salts.</p><p><strong>8. How much does paint protection film cost?</strong><br>The cost of paint protection film varies depending on the coverage area, film quality, and the type of vehicle. Full vehicle coverage can range from $2,000 to $5,000, while part of vehicle coverage is more affordable.</p><p><strong>9. Does paint protection film affect vehicle resale value?</strong><br>Yes, applying paint protection film can enhance a vehicle’s resale value by maintaining its original paint condition and preventing damage from road hazards and environmental factors.</p><p><strong>10. Can paint protection film be used on any type of vehicle?</strong><br>Yes, paint protection film can be applied to a variety of vehicle types, including luxury cars, sports cars, SUVs, and even motorcycles, providing protection for both high-end and everyday vehicles.</p>```<strong><br /> </strong></p><p><strong>For More Information or Query, Visit @<a title=" High-end Paint Protection Film Market Size And Forecast 2025-2030" href="https://www.verifiedmarketreports.com/product/high-end-paint-protection-film-market/" target="_blank"> High-end Paint Protection Film Market Size And Forecast 2025-2030</a></strong></p><p>&nbsp;</p>
